7 передача данных по fieldbus – fhpp и ds 402, 1 обмен данными по canopen, Передача данных по fieldbus – fhpp и ds 402 – Инструкция по эксплуатации Festo Контроллер двигателя SFC-ST

Страница 45: Обмен данными по canopen

Advertising
background image

1. Обзор системы

1-23

Festo P.BE-SFC-DC-CO-RU ru 1005b

1.7

Передача данных по Fieldbus

FHPP и DS 402

1.7.1 Обмен данными по CANopen

Устройства CANopen имеют каталог объектов, благодаря которому

возможен доступ стандартным способом ко всем основным

параметрам участников. Конфигурация системы CANopen

происходит посредством доступа к объектам отдельных абонентов

из перечня. Обмен данными по CANopen происходит в форме

телеграмм, в которых передаются полезные данные. Различают

объекты сервисных данных (SDO), которые используются для

передачи сервисных данных от и к перечню объектов, а также

объекты данных процесса (PDO), которые служат быстрой

передаче текущих состояний процесса. Дополнительно

определяются телеграммы в сеть менеджмента для передачи по

каналам связи.

SDO

С помощью SDOs можно получить доступ ко всем записям перечня

объектов. Назначение адреса соответствующей записи в перечне

объектов происходит посредством задания индекса и субиндекса

записи. SDO обычно используются для передачи нецикличных

данных, например, для инициализации в ходе процесса загрузки.

Внутри SDO может совершаться доступ только к одному объекту.

На SDO дается ответ: передается одна CAN-телеграмма на объект.

PDO

PDO являются в принципе сводной таблицей объектов

(переменные или параметры) из перечня объектов. В одном PDO

могут отсылаться до 8 байт из различных объектах, т.е. объекты

включена в PDO. Объекты Process Data Object могут передаваться с

управлением по событиям, синхронно с системой или по запросу.

PDO передаются через сообщения CAN и предназначаются для

передачи цикличных данных.

Advertising